الفصل الثالث: تطبيق قاعدة البيانات لإنشاء صفحات ويب ديناميكية
القسم 7: إنشاء استعلام بسيط
في الواقع، مبدأ إنشاء الاستعلام هو نفس مبدأ تحرير البيانات الذي تعلمناه أعلاه، حيث يقومون أولاً بتمرير القيمة من الصفحة الأولى إلى الصفحة الثانية، ثم تأخذ الصفحة الثانية القيمة المقابلة بناءً على القيمة التي تم تمريرها. سجل، ثم قم بإجراء المعالجة المقابلة، مثل العرض والتحرير والحذف. الفرق هو طريقة التسليم في القسم السابق مررنا القيمة من خلال اتصال العنوان، ونعلم أن الاستعلامات العامة يتم ملؤها بالبيانات من خلال نموذج ثم إرسالها.
حسنًا، دعونا نلقي نظرة على عملية الإنشاء المحددة.
نحتاج أولاً إلى إنشاء صفحة حيث يمكن للمستخدمين إدخال محتوى الاستعلام. كما هو موضح في الشكل، نقوم بإدراج حقل نموذج يسمى بحث مع كتابة نص وزر إرسال. لاحظ أنه يجب استخدام اسم حقل النموذج هذا بعده. يمكن أن يكون الاسم هو ما تختاره. ثم نضيف صفحة تنفيذ لحقل النموذج هذا. ضع المؤشر على الخط الأحمر، وستظهر لوحة خصائص النموذج. في عمود الإجراء، قم بملء عنوان الصفحة التي تريد الاستعلام عنها ومعالجتها. وهنا نستخدم searchdo.asp لمعالجتها. سوف نقوم بإنشاء هذه الصفحة لاحقا. بعد اكتمال كافة هذه الإعدادات، احفظ هذه الصفحة باسم search.asp، وستكون الصفحة الأولى التي نستخدمها لتمرير القيمة جاهزة.
بعد ذلك نقوم بإنشاء صفحة ثانية، وهي searchdo.asp. كالعادة، افتح اللوحة لإنشاء مجموعة سجلات، كما هو موضح في الشكل. هل رأيت أي فرق؟ بالمناسبة، يظهر متغير النموذج في عامل التصفية. اسمحوا لي أن أوضح. تحديد اسم المستخدم في عامل التصفية يعني أن النطاق الذي نريد البحث فيه هو حقل اسم المستخدم. في عمود الشرط، نختار احتواء، مما يعني أن قاعدة البيانات ستعرض بيانات حقل اسم المستخدم طالما أن هذا الحقل يحتوي على المحتوى الذي أدخله المستخدم. على سبيل المثال، يحتوي اسم المستخدم على المحتوى التالي a، aac، aaac. إذا قام المستخدم بالبحث باستخدام، فسيتم عرض البيانات الثلاثة جميعها. إذا قام المستخدم بالبحث باستخدام ac، فسيتم عرض كل من aac وaaac. يعني متغير النموذج أن مجموعة السجلات تقبل القيمة التي تم تمريرها عبر النموذج. البحث هو اسم حقل النموذج الخاص بنا. إذا كان اسم حقل النموذج الخاص بك هو سلسلة البحث، فيجب تغييره إلى سلسلة البحث وفقًا لذلك. انقر فوق "موافق" ويتم إنشاء مجموعة السجلات الخاصة بنا.
بعد إنشاء مجموعة السجلات، كل ما يتعين علينا فعله هو عرض السجلات وفقًا لطريقة عرض السجلات الموضحة أعلاه.
افتح نافذة المتصفح واعرض مخرجات البرنامج.
هذا هو رمز Sql الذي أنشأه لنا Ultradev عندما نقرنا على الزر "خيارات متقدمة". هل رأيت ذلك Request.Form("بحث")؟ يبدو مألوفا. *_'
تم هنا وصف بعض الوظائف الأساسية لبرنامج Dreamweaver Ultradev، بعد قراءة هذا يا صديقي، يجب أن تكون قادرًا على القيام ببعض وظائف عرض البيانات الأساسية وتصفحها وتحريرها وحذفها. بعد ذلك، سنتحدث أولاً عن وظيفة استخدام المكونات الإضافية لـ Ultradev، ثم سنقوم بدمج ما تعلمناه من خلال برنامج بسيط لإدارة خلفية موقع الويب.
لماذا يجب أن نتحدث عن استخدام المكونات الإضافية أولاً لأنه في كثير من الأحيان يمكننا استخدام المكونات الإضافية لتنفيذ بعض الوظائف بسهولة، وسيتم أيضًا استخدام بعض المكونات الإضافية في برنامج إدارة الخلفية اللاحق، لذلك سنتحدث عن الاستخدام الأساسي للمكونات الإضافية أولاً. يرجى الانتباه.